Set up gauge bars are the simplest way to set fence and cutter height. The risk of damage to a carbide cutting edge is greatly reduced because brass is much softer than the tool. Sizes are 1/8, 3/16, 1/4, 3/8 and 1/2 square, and they may be stacked for a wider range of sizes. At 2-1/2 inches long these blocks are plenty long enough to bridge the gap between the cutter and the table around it. Comes in a handy storage compartment.
